Who We Are

Pulpmill Services, Inc. (PSI) primary business is the manufacturing, installation, repair and refurbishing of pulping equipment, diversifying into industrial general construction including concrete, structural steel, piping and mechanical projects. PSI is a full-service fabrication, welding, and machine shop utilizing advanced CNC machines, water jet and plasma tables and large horizontal and vertical milling machines.

Summary/Objective

The Field Supervisor is responsible for managing a field crew at on-site jobs ensuring all safety rules are being adhered to. This position is also responsible for the planning, coordination, and execution of employees and their assigned duties.

This position requires the employee to perform a wide variety of duties including, but not limited to the following key functions:

  • Be available as the on-site point of contact.
  • Estimate needed manpower for each job.
  • Provide qualified candidates to form and/or fill a crew.
  • Obtain job opportunities to ensure available work for crews. 
  • Set priority of workflow to ensure due dates are met.
  • Recommend, specify and requisition appropriate tooling for each job.
  • Ensure a safe work site and follow mill specific rules.
  • Coordinate all items needed to complete each job to include equipment, materials, employees, etc.
  • Assist in quoting with regards to employees needed, time estimates, and materials and tools needed.
  • Confirm PSI quality standards are met at all times.
  • Troubleshoot and resolve any issues and/or equipment malfunctions. 
  • Perform all duties in a safe and efficient manner.
  • Willing to learn and perform other tasks and duties as needed.
